What Cloud-Native Application Development Means

Cloud-native application development refers to the process of designing and building applications specifically for cloud environments. These applications are optimized for scalability, flexibility, resilience, and continuous delivery.

Cloud-native architectures commonly use technologies such as microservices, containers, Kubernetes orchestration, DevOps practices, and automated CI/CD pipelines. Instead of relying on large monolithic systems, applications are broken into smaller independent services that can be updated and managed separately.

Popular platforms such as Kubernetes, Red Hat OpenShift, and Docker play a major role in supporting cloud-native application development across modern enterprise environments.

Enhancing Scalability and Flexibility

One of the biggest advantages of cloud-native applications is scalability. Organizations can scale individual services dynamically based on demand instead of scaling entire systems unnecessarily.

For example, during periods of high customer activity, businesses can allocate additional resources automatically to specific application components. This improves performance while optimizing infrastructure costs.

Improving Application Reliability and Resilience

System reliability is critical for businesses operating in digital environments where downtime can negatively impact operations and customer trust. Traditional monolithic systems often create single points of failure.

Cloud-native applications improve resilience by distributing workloads across multiple independent services and cloud environments. If one component fails, other services can continue operating without affecting the entire application.

Automated recovery and orchestration technologies also help maintain high availability and reduce operational disruptions, ensuring consistent performance across enterprise systems.

Strengthening Cost Efficiency and Resource Optimization

Traditional IT infrastructures often require organizations to maintain expensive hardware and overprovision resources to handle peak workloads. Cloud-native environments optimize resource usage through dynamic scaling and automation.

Organizations only use the computing resources they need, reducing infrastructure costs and improving operational efficiency. Automated resource management also minimizes waste and improves overall system utilization.
